Summary : An Open Source MQTT v3.1/v3.1.1 Broker
Description :
Mosquitto is an open source message broker that implements the MQ Telemetry
Transport protocol version 3.1 and 3.1.1 MQTT provides a lightweight method
of carrying out messaging using a publish/subscribe model. This makes it
suitable for "machine to machine" messaging such as with low power sensors
or mobile devices such as phones, embedded computers or micro-controllers
like the Arduino.

Summary : Locking wrapper script
Description :
withlock is a locking wrapper script to make sure that some program
isn't run more than once. It is ideal to prevent periodic jobs spawned
by cron from stacking up.
The locks created are valid only while the wrapper is running, and
thus will never require additional cleanup, even after a reboot. This
makes the wrapper safe and easy to use, and much better than
implementing half-hearted locking within scripts.

Summary : Linear Algebra over F_2
Description :
M4RI is a library for fast arithmetic with dense matrices over F_2.
The name M4RI comes from the first implemented algorithm: The "Method
of the Four Russians" inversion algorithm published by Gregory Bard.
M4RI is used by the Sage mathematics software and the PolyBoRi library.

Summary : High-performance algorithms for vectors, matrices, and polynomials
Description :
NTL is a high-performance, portable C++ library providing data structures
and algorithms for arbitrary length integers; for vectors, matrices, and
polynomials over the integers and over finite fields; and for arbitrary
precision floating point arithmetic.
NTL provides high quality implementations of state-of-the-art algorithms for:
* arbitrary length integer arithmetic and arbitrary precision floating point
arithmetic;
* polynomial arithmetic over the integers and finite fields including basic
arithmetic, polynomial factorization, irreducibility testing, computation
of minimal polynomials, traces, norms, and more;
* lattice basis reduction, including very robust and fast implementations of
Schnorr-Euchner, block Korkin-Zolotarev reduction, and the new
Schnorr-Horner pruning heuristic for block Korkin-Zolotarev;
* basic linear algebra over the integers, finite fields, and arbitrary
precision floating point numbers.
